Block
#13,580,144
1d
40 txs6,365 confs
Transactions
40
Total Output
₳25,734,160.71
$3.92M
Fees
₳14.79
Size
58.12 KB
59,513 bytes
Details
Hash
ba140ac6659906a0c0dc3f9ef7303ec5908c78c36d782a9274e456f5c4e2a90a
Epoch / Slot
Epoch 638 · slot 190,510,887 · epoch-slot 258,087
Timestamp
1d · Sun, 21 Jun 2026 21:26:18 GMT
Block producer
VRF key
vrf_vk10…kssp84qv
Op cert
ce1fce67…b6a63d30
Op cert counter
35
Transactions in block30